Meet the Staff

Michael J Halstead
Manager

I was appointed Manager of the Bay County Animal Control facility on October 03, 2007.  I am a retiree of the Bay City Fire Department where I served as the Fire Marshal.  I look forward to the many challenges presented in managing the Bay County Animal Control and Shelter.  Please come visit us at the facility.

Lee Carrasco
Animal Control Officer

I am a certified Animal Control Officer through the Michigan Department of Agriculture and deputized through the Bay County Sheriff's Department.  I am an experienced officer with over 15 years of service.  My training and schooling was accomplished through the Michigan Association of Animal Control Officers, the National Animal Control Association and the Michigan Humane Society.

Russell Johnson
Animal Control Officer

I have been employed by Bay County Animal Control since 1997.  I am certified through the Department of Agriculture as an Animal Control Officer and deputized through the Bay County Sheriff's Department.  I am a graduate from Ferris State University and hold a bachelors degree in criminal justice.  I have obtained training through the Michigan Association of Animal Control Officers and numerous other organizations.  Some of the specialized training I have acquired is in chemical immobilization, animal first aid and large animal evaluations.

Lee Zielinski
Animal Control Officer

I have worked for Bay County Animal Control, as an officer, since 1997.  Like the rest of our officers, I am certified through the Department of Agriculture and deputized through the Bay County Sheriff's Department.  I graduated from Michigan State University in 1996 with a bachelors degree in criminal justice. While working with the Department I have attended numerous conferences and seminars, including training in chemical immobilization, animal cruelty investigations, animal first aid, large animal handling, and various other skills.
